Send me your mold, and I'll put it in my vac former. I've got the
technique down pretty good, and I'm looking for new challenges. It ain't easy if you want anything with a greater than 1:1 length to
diameter ratio. I've done it by building my own "box" and using an
electrolux canister vacuum cleaner. Sheets of plastic were clamped
between masonite "frames" and heated in the oven.
Big pain in the buttocks.
